EasyShop的管理层希望将商品分为便宜、可负担、昂贵和非常昂贵四类。如果商品单价在0和499之间,则分类为“便宜”;如果在500和1999之间,则分类为“可负担”;如果在2000和4999之间,则分类为“昂贵”;如果价格大于或等于5000,则分类为“非常昂贵”。编写一个查询以显示项目类型和项目分类。按项类型和分类以升序显示唯一行。
这是我的问题
SELECT DISTINCT ItemType,
CASE
Price BETWEEN 0 AND 499 THEN 'Cheap'
Price BETWEEN 500 AND 1999 THEN 'Affordable&
在搜索了一段时间的可用代码之后,我发现这可以检查列A中的值是否相同。如果是这样,则对G列中的任何内容进行汇总,而不是删除所有其他列。
现在,我需要代码能够保持A到E列,并将F到I的值相加。
代码:
Dim WorkRng As Range
Dim Dic As Variant
Dim arr As Variant
On Error Resume Next
xTitleId = "KutoolsforExcel"
Range("A2:I10000").Select
Set WorkRng = Application.Selection
Set WorkRng =
我们有一张有产品的桌子和一张有目前选择/种类的产品的桌子。现在需要加入它们,通过一些.net代码创建一个导出文件。
目前使用的查询如下:
SELECT * FROM ASSORTMENT a
INNER JOIN PRODUCTS p on a.clientID = 38 and a.productID = p.productID
ORDER BY a.ID_ROW OFFSET 100000 ROWS FETCH NEXT 1000 ROWS ONLY
问题是,分类可以包含停止的产品,这些产品不再存在于products表中,因此需要一个连接来验证。还需要每次选择的行数完全相同,例如1000行
我试着根据购买的商品数量来“分类”我所有的顾客,并显示每个分类的数量。我正在尝试查看有多少人(Account_id)购买了一件商品,有多少人购买了两件商品,一直到九件商品,然后是十件或更多。
下面是我正在使用的查询-为了生成结果,我希望该查询对sales执行全表扫描,但整个过程永远都会耗费时间!
我来自Oracle背景,我像在Oracle中一样编写了查询。
select thecnt
, count(*)
from (select count(*)
, case when count(*) >= 10 then 'te
我目前正在使用支持向量机来预测用户会在给定的人口统计数据下购买哪种商品。数据集还包括某个年龄段的用户购买了每件商品的数量。它看起来像这样:
items a b c
age
15-20 10 3 10
20-25 1 5 6
25-30 2 5 6
我不确定如何将其合并到训练数据中,因为我能想到的唯一合并方法是包括一组购买商品的用户的概率值,但这非常笨拙。我的另一个想法是使用集成学习方法,将支持向量机与朴素贝叶斯分类器结合起来。我正在使用sklearn来构建我的模型。
我正在用VB.net编写一个控制台应用程序,需要知道如果用户将字符串输入到声明为整数的变量中,如何防止应用程序崩溃。我该怎么做?
应用程序获取用户输入的4位数的商品代码,将其存储在变量中,并使用该代码对商品进行分类,然后在输入所有商品的代码(即500)后,应用程序会打印出每个商品的数量。如果输入代码中包含字母或符号,一旦按下Enter,应用程序就会崩溃,因为变量不能接受字符串作为输入。我尝试寻找另一种数据类型,可以接受它作为输入,然后输出错误消息,但我找不到任何东西。
Dim itmCode As Integer
Console.WriteLine("Input 4-digit it
我有几个excel数据文件,每个文件都涉及不同的时间(例如,0h、24h、48h、……),其中包含感兴趣数据的列名为“Product”和“Value”。我使用以下方法将这些文件连接起来:
result = pd.concat([pd.read_excel(file) for file in filenames], keys=t_list, names=['t'])
其中文件名是包含excel文件的列表,t_list是包含时间的列表,t是新创建的列的名称。到目前为止,我得到了一个具有以下结构的新的dataframe:
级联Dataframe:
但是,如果我对以下几点进行分类